Summary

This research study is studying a drug called atezolizumab as a possible treatment HER2-positive metastatic breast cancer (MBC) that has spread to the brain.

The names of the study drugs involved in this study are:

* Atezolizumab
* Pertuzumab
* Trastuzumab
